Enhanced Cadet Protection: New Rules Against Harassment and Assault

This act introduces new rules to enhance the safety of cadets at the United States Merchant Marine Academy. It focuses on preventing and responding to sexual harassment and assault, as well as improving mental health support and diversity. Citizens can expect maritime institutions to become safer places for learning and working.
Key points
Suspension or revocation of merchant mariner credentials for perpetrators of sexual harassment or assault.
Establishment of an information management system to track sexual assault and harassment incidents at the Merchant Marine Academy.
Creation of a Sexual Assault Advisory Council, composed of experts and victims, to review policies.
Requirement for a Diversity and Inclusion Action Plan, including training and resources.
Provision of Special Victims' Counsel for cadets who are victims of sex-related offenses.
Mandatory comprehensive in-person sexual assault risk-reduction and response training for all midshipmen.
